摘要:
[Objective]The research aimed to analyze temporal-spatial change characteristics of the precipitation in the four provinces of northwest China. [Method]Based on precipitation data at 113 ground observation stations in the four provinces (Shaanxi,Gansu,Qinghai and Ningxia) of northwest China from 1961 to 2008,by using linear regression and Morlet wavelet transformation,spatial pattern,change trend and periodic characteristics of the precipitation in the zone in 48 years were analyzed. [Result]Rainfall in the four provinces of northwest China had obvious interannual and seasonal change characteristics. Annual,spring and autumn rainfalls all presented decline trends. Summer and winter rainfalls both had slight increase trends,but change trend wasn't obvious. Precipitation change in the four provinces of northwest China had obvious regional difference. Increase amplitudes in Tanggula Mountains,Tsaidam Basin and east Qilian Mountains were obvious. Obvious decrease amplitude existed in east Gansu,south and north Shaanxi. Precipitation in east and west areas of the four provinces in northwest China presented reverse phase change characteristics. Precipitation presented decrease trend in east and increase trend in most areas of west. Precipitation in the whole district,east district and west district generally had 3-5-year short period,which was main period. Precipitation also had 8-year and 15-year medium periods in some areas. Under different time scales,dry-wet alternation and mutation point had difference. [Conclusion]The research provided theoretical basis for studying climate change in northwest China.
